Bill Summary

Relative to use by caregivers of earned time for school closings

AI Summary

This bill amends the existing law to allow caregivers to use their earned time off to care for their dependent child when the child's school is cancelled due to weather or other emergency situations. The bill adds this new provision to the existing law, which allows employees to use their earned time off to address the effects of domestic violence or to care for a family member. The key change is the addition of a new paragraph that specifically permits the use of earned time off for school closures, providing more flexibility for working parents and caregivers.
